AFCAT 2 2017 Result Declared- Check Your AFCAT Result Here

AFCAT 2 2017 Result has been finally declared by the Indian Air Force. Yesterday, it was notified by the Indian Air Force that AFCAT Result 2017 will be most probably declared on 13th of October (Today) and they stick to their words.  Today, the Air Force has finally released the detailed result that includes AFCAT 2 2017 cut off in both AFCAT 02/2017 and EKT Exam.

The list of candidates who appeared for AFCAT 2 2017 held on 27 August and 17th September has been displayed on the official website of Indian Airforce. The cut off for AFCAT exam has been selected based on the requirement of IAF, the performance of candidates in the exam and the overall competition of the candidates during the examination.

Cut Off Marks for AFCAT 2 2017:


The Indian Air Force has given that all the candidates who have minimum 160 marks out of 300 have been shortlisted for the AFSB. In terms of EKT, the candidates who have earned 60 marks out of 150 marks will be considered for Technical Branch in the Indian Air Force.

AFCAT 2 201 7 Cut off Marks: 1 6 0 / 300

EKT Cut off Marks: 60 / 150

A special note has been given by the IAF that all the candidates who have been shortlisted in AFCAT 2 2017 Result, as well as EKT, will be eligible for the Technical Branch.

The attached list encompass the Roll Number of all the selected candidates who have cleared the examination. They can check their roll number and ensure their selection. All the selected candidates need to login to their Candidate Login and choose the AFSB date and venue.

Indian Air Force has disclosed that all the shortlisted candidates can select the venue and date for Air Force Selection Boards (AFSBs) from 13th of October to 19th October. The candidates will be allotted their preferred center and dates on first come first serve basis.

If somehow you forget to select the venue and date within the given time slot, you will not get the venue of your choice, instead, will be allotted the dates and AFSB centre according to the available seats in AFSB dates. It’s mandatory for everyone to reach the AFSB venue by the due date.

How to check AFCAT 2 2017 Result and Cut Off Marks ?


  • Like other competitive exams, the AFCAT 2 2017 Result will be declared online.
  • To get your result status, open the official Indian Air Force career website i.e. http://www.careerairforce.nic.in/
  • Click on the “Candidate Login” present at the top right part of the website
  • You will get three options i.e. “AFCAT Entry”, “Meteorological Branch Entry” and “NCC Flying Branch Entry”. Select the first option i.e. AFCAT Entry.
  • Now as a part of promotion, you will be shown a motivational video of Indian Air Force. You need to click on “Skip Video”.
  • A Candidate’s login dashboard will open asking for your username and password. Enter the details carefully. If you forget your password click on “Forget Password” to get the password by email.
  • In your dashboard, you will get the option to check your AFCAT 2 2917 Result. You will be shown the AFCAT 2 2017 Cut off Marks and the marks you have obtained.
  • If you have successfully qualified the exam, you will find a button “Generate Admin Card”. It’s mandatory to carry your Admin card to the AFSB centre. It will be verified after you clear the first stage at SSB.
  • After you have seen your positive result, you need to select the AFSB interview dates. As the SSB Interview dates will be provided on first come first serve basis, you need to be quick while selecting your SSB dates.

Important Notice by Indian Air Force:


  • All the candidates are required to read the instructions available at careerairforce.nic.in carefully before reporting to AFSB.
  • The shortlisted candidates who have applied for Flying Branch can select the AFSB centre among 1 AFSB (Dehradun), 2 AFSB (Mysore) or 4 AFSB (Varanasi) as their AFSB  centre.
